VSCode中的文件关联(File Associations)设置方法


VSCode 文件关联通过 settings.json 中的 "files.associations" 字段将文件后缀映射到语言模式,支持通配符和精确匹配,分用户级与工作区级设置,配置后需验证状态栏语言名或使用“Change Language Mode”调试。

vscode中的文件关联(file associations)设置方法

在 VSCode 中,文件关联(File Associations)用于告诉编辑器:某类后缀名的文件应该用哪种语言模式(Language Mode)来高亮、语法检查和提供智能提示。正确设置能解决“代码没高亮”“自动补全不工作”等问题。

通过设置界面快速配置

这是最直观的方式,适合临时调整或新手使用:

  • 打开 VSCode,按 Ctrl + ,(Windows/Linux)或 Cmd + ,(Mac)进入设置界面
  • 在右上角搜索框输入 files.associations
  • 点击 “在 settings.json 中编辑” 链接(右侧带铅笔图标的按钮)
  • 在打开的 settings.json 文件中添加或修改 "files.associations" 字段

手动编辑 settings.json 添加规则

所有文件关联最终都落在用户或工作区的 settings.json 中。格式为键值对:键是文件后缀(支持通配符),值是语言标识符(如 j*ascriptmarkdown):

  • 例如,让所有 .es 文件按 J*aScript 解析:"*.es": "j*ascript"
  • webpack.config.js 按 J*aScript 解析(精确匹配):"webpack.config.js": "j*ascript"
  • .mdx 文件用 MDX 支持(需先安装对应扩展):"*.mdx": "mdx"
  • 注意:语言标识符必须是 VSCode 或已启用扩展所注册的,可通过状态栏右下角点击语言名查看当前有效值

区分用户级与工作区级设置

文件关联可以设在两个位置,作用范围不同:

凡诺企业网站管理系统商业版 1.5 试用版 凡诺企业网站管理系统商业版 1.5 试用版

系统优势:  全DIV+CSS模板,多浏览器适应,完美兼容IE6-IE8,以及Firefox Opera 等符合标准的浏览器,模板样式集中在一个CSS文件中,内容与样式完全分离,方便网站设计人员开发模板与管理。系统较为安全,以设计防注入,敏感字符屏蔽。新闻,产品,单页独立关键字设计,提高搜索引擎收录。  调试环境必须为IIS  后台账户密码:admin功能介绍:基本信息设置:网站名称,联系人等信息

凡诺企业网站管理系统商业版 1.5 试用版 0 查看详情 凡诺企业网站管理系统商业版 1.5 试用版
  • 用户设置(User Settings):全局生效,路径通常为 %APPDATA%\Code\User\settings.json(Win)或 ~/Library/Application Support/Code/User/settings.json(Mac)
  • 工作区设置(Workspace Settings):仅对当前文件夹(含 .vscode/settings.json)生效,适合项目特定规则,比如把 config.yaml 关联为 ansible 语言
  • 工作区设置会覆盖用户设置,优先级更高

验证与调试技巧

改完设置后,不一定立即生效,可这样确认是否成功:

  • 打开目标文件,看右下角状态栏显示的语言名是否符合预期(如显示 “J*aScript” 而不是 “Plain Text”)
  • Ctrl + Shift + P 输入 “Change Language Mode”,回车后可临时切换并测试效果
  • 如果语言未列出,说明该语言模式未被加载——可能需要安装对应扩展(如 Vue、Rust、TOML 等)
  • 重启 VSCode 或重新打开文件,有时可解决缓存导致的延迟识别

基本上就这些。文件关联不复杂但容易忽略,配对准确后,编辑体验会明显提升。

以上就是VSCode中的文件关联(File Associations)设置方法的详细内容,更多请关注其它相关文章!


# 鼠标  # 农林行业网站建设  # 清水河专业网站建设  # 网站编程seo  # 威信网站推广怎么做  # 娄底百度营销推广排名  # 淘宝网站的推广方式  # 嘉定租房网站建设  # 优化网站制作表格  # 本地网站如何推广营销  # 吉林大型网站建设方法  # 有效值  # 这是  # 区级  # 状态栏  # linux  # 让你  # 企业网站  # 管理系统  # 文件关联  # 试用版  # ap  # windows  # json  # markdown  # js  # vscode  # java  # javascript  # vue 


相关栏目: 【 Google疑问12 】 【 Facebook疑问10 】 【 优化推广96088 】 【 技术知识133117 】 【 IDC资讯59369 】 【 网络运营7196 】 【 IT资讯61894


相关推荐: PyEZ 配置提交中 RpcTimeoutError 的健壮性处理策略  纯CSS实现自适应宽度与响应式布局的水平按钮组  快手网页版官方访问 快手网页版页面在线打开  极兔快递官网查询入口手机版 手机极兔快递登录查询入口官方  Pandas中基于动态偏移量实现DataFrame列值位移的策略  研招网官方网站正版登录网址_中国研究生招生信息网官网首页  vivo手机视频通话美颜怎么设置_vivo视频通话美颜开启方法  C++二维数组动态分配方法_C++指针与数组内存布局  使用CSS :has() 选择器实现父元素样式控制:从子元素反向应用样式  包子漫画官网链接官方地址 包子漫画在线观看官网首页入口  小米civi如何设置锁屏时间  如何在Golang中处理表单文件上传_Golang 表单文件上传示例  如何在CSS中使用absolute实现登录弹窗居中_transform translate结合  《下一站江湖2》心法融合技巧  传统曲艺莲花落的表演形式是  Composer如何使用composer-plugin-api开发自定义插件  J*a中的值传递到底指什么_值传递模型在参数传递中的真正含义说明  猫眼电影app如何筛选支持退改签的影院_猫眼电影退改签影院筛选方法  mysql怎么导入sql文件_mysql导入sql文件的方法与技巧  电脑的“恢复环境(WinRE)”找不到怎么办_Windows系统恢复环境重建【高级修复】  荣耀 Magic10 Pro 系统更新提示失败_荣耀 Magic10 Pro 升级修复  Flexbox布局:实现粘性导航与底部页脚的完美结合  DeepSeek超全面指南:入门必看  优化Leaflet弹出层图片显示:条件渲染策略  C++中std::thread和std::async的区别_C++并发编程与线程与异步任务比较  鼠标没反应了怎么办 无线/有线鼠标失灵的解决方法【详解】  win11如何运行chkdsk命令 Win11检查和修复磁盘逻辑错误教程【修复】  获取WooCommerce产品在后台编辑页面的分类ID  京东快递包裹信息查询入口 京东快递官方查询平台入口  行者app怎样导出日志  三星A55应用闪退排查步骤_Samsung A55稳定性优化技巧  掌握CSS :has() 选择器:父选择器、嵌套限制与常见陷阱解析  抖音如何解除|直播|权限绑定_抖音关闭并解绑|直播|功能的方法  《全民k歌》音乐怎么下载到本地2025  PHP utf8_encode 字符编码转换陷阱与解决方案  Golang如何实现HTTP请求重试机制_Golang HTTP请求错误处理策略  《雅迪智行》用手机开锁方法  漫蛙漫画直连入口 _ manwa官方备用入口实时检测  抖音火山版注销账号抖音会注销吗 抖音火山版与抖音账号注销关系  阿里云共享相册入口在哪  电脑双系统如何安装和卸载 Windows和Linux双系统安装教程【详解】  批改网官网首页登录 批改网学生用户登录入口  pubmed数据库官方主页_pubmed学术论文查找官网直达  Vue 3中独立响应式实例的创建与应用  TikTok网页版入口快速访问 TikTok官网账号登录方法  win11资源管理器标签页怎么用 Win11文件管理器多标签高效操作【新功能】  《腾讯相册管家》注销账号方法  todesk如何添加信任设备_todesk信任设备设置教程  word文档行距怎么调?word文档调行距的操作步骤  百度识图图像分析 百度识图识别平台 

 2025-12-17

了解您产品搜索量及市场趋势,制定营销计划

同行竞争及网站分析保障您的广告效果

点击免费数据支持

提交您的需求,1小时内享受我们的专业解答。

运城市盐湖区信雨科技有限公司


运城市盐湖区信雨科技有限公司

运城市盐湖区信雨科技有限公司是一家深耕海外推广领域十年的专业服务商,作为谷歌推广与Facebook广告全球合作伙伴,聚焦外贸企业出海痛点,以数字化营销为核心,提供一站式海外营销解决方案。公司凭借十年行业沉淀与平台官方资源加持,打破传统外贸获客壁垒,助力企业高效开拓全球市场,成为中小企业出海的可靠合作伙伴。

 8156699

 13765294890

 8156699@qq.com

Notice

We and selected third parties use cookies or similar technologies for technical purposes and, with your consent, for other purposes as specified in the cookie policy.
You can consent to the use of such technologies by closing this notice, by interacting with any link or button outside of this notice or by continuing to browse otherwise.